Russell McCreven Obituary

Russell James McCreven
January 14, 1939 ~ October 18, 2025
Russell James McCreven, 86, of West Haven, CT, passed away peacefully, after a long battle with Parkinson's, surrounded by love, on October 18, 2025. Born on January 14, 1939, he was a son of Edward J. McCreven, Sr. and Mabel Berthrong Russell McCreven. He was predeceased by his brother Edward J. McCreven Jr., and his beloved wife of 44 years, Ann Hackett McCreven.
A graduate of West Haven High School (Class of 1956), Quinnipiac College, and Fairfield University, after service in the National Guard, Russell devoted his career to teaching at West Haven High School. He retired in 1996 after 35 years, having served as head of the Social Studies department since 1965. He was also teacher's union WHFT (AFL-CIO) president in the early 1970s.
A passionate "Westie," his lifetime love of local sports included work announcing WHHS hockey games and his second career as a photographer and sportswriter. For decades, he could be spotted on the sidelines with his camera, documenting the achievements of generations of student athletes. He was inducted into the West Haven Athletics Hall of Fame and was honored to receive the Tinker Blake Community Service Award in 2022.
